I just got mine up and running and I had a couple things that I missed before everything clicked. One big item is the E stop that they shipped with the kit, did you replace your old one with that? Also, besides just having the laser control set to armed you have to click the dial/button each time to enable it to fire. Have you done both of those?

Thank you. Yes I have. I can get the laser to fire with the control box in test mode, but not from the software. The control box always shows that the pwm is 0. I am going to try and write some gcode that just turns on the laser and then look inside the Aux box wiring with a scope.

Does the laser deploy (i.e. the air cylinder drops the laser into position) and the air assist turns on?

Yes. It does everything but fire under software control. I can test fire it with different pwm values from the control module. I am bit baffled right now.
